The formula of a gaseous hydrocarbon which requires 6 times of its own volume of O2O_2O2​ for complete oxidation and produces 4 times its own volume of CO2CO_2CO2​ is CxHy. The value of y is ‾\underline{\hspace{2cm}}​.
Numerical answer
View written solutionFree

Correct answer: 8

  1. Let the gaseous hydrocarbon be CxHy\mathrm{C_xH_y}Cx​Hy​.

  2. For complete combustion, the balanced reaction is:

CxHy+(x+y4)O2→xCO2+y2H2O\mathrm{C_xH_y + \left(x + \frac{y}{4}\right)O_2 \rightarrow xCO_2 + \frac{y}{2}H_2O}Cx​Hy​+(x+4y​)O2​→xCO2​+2y​H2​O
  1. Since all gases are compared at the same temperature and pressure, volumes are proportional to mole ratios.

  2. Given:

  • Hydrocarbon requires 666 times its own volume of O2O_2O2​
  • Hydrocarbon produces 444 times its own volume of CO2CO_2CO2​

So from the reaction stoichiometry:

x+y4=6x + \frac{y}{4} = 6x+4y​=6

and

x=4x = 4x=4
  1. Substitute x=4x=4x=4 into the first equation:
4+y4=64 + \frac{y}{4} = 64+4y​=6 y4=2\frac{y}{4} = 24y​=2 y=8y = 8y=8
  1. Therefore, the hydrocarbon is C4H8\mathrm{C_4H_8}C4​H8​, and the required value is:
8\boxed{8}8​
